Typically, awarded tenders in Gauteng are issued by government entities, municipalities, and parastatals. These bodies are mandated to ensure compliance with the Public Finance Management Act (PFMA) and the Municipal Finance Management Act (MFMA), which govern procurement processes in South Africa. Businesses must familiarize themselves with these regulations to ensure their bids are compliant and competitive.

When applying for tenders, businesses should pay close attention to the specific requirements outlined in the tender documents. Each bid must be tailored to the project specifications, including timelines, budget constraints, and quality standards. It is essential to demonstrate not only technical capability but also past performance and experience in similar projects. Additionally, understanding the local context and incorporating sustainability practices can enhance a bid's attractiveness.

Networking and building relationships with government officials and other contractors can also provide valuable insights into upcoming opportunities and the nuances of the procurement process. Attending industry events and workshops can be beneficial. Lastly, ensure that all required documentation is complete and submitted on time, as late submissions are often disqualified.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of construction tenders are available in Gauteng?
In Gauteng, construction tenders often include infrastructure projects such as road upgrades, building maintenance, and renewable energy installations. These tenders cater to a wide range of construction activities, from large-scale projects to minor refurbishments.
How can I find out about upcoming construction tenders?
Upcoming construction tenders can be found through government websites, municipal portals, and industry publications. Additionally, subscribing to newsletters and alerts from relevant procurement bodies can help businesses stay informed.
What are the typical requirements for applying for tenders?
Typical requirements for applying for tenders include submitting a comprehensive proposal that outlines your company's experience, qualifications, and financial capabilities. Documentation such as tax clearance certificates, B-BBEE certificates, and proof of insurance may also be required.
